Warning Signs You Need Insulation Water Damage Restoration

Water damage to your insulation can be a costly and time-consuming issue if left unchecked.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ong musty smells can show water damage or high humidity levels. If you notice a persistent odor,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your ceiling, walls, or insulation can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Insulation

Warped or buckled insulation can be a sign of moisture damage. This can lead to energy inefficiencies and even structural issues if left unchecked.

Musty or Mildewy Insulation

Musty or mildewy insulation can be a sign of high humidity levels or water damage. This can lead to health risks and energy inefficiencies if left unchecked.

Water Droplets or Condensation

Water droplets or condensation on your insulation or walls can be a sign of high humidity levels or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Increased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can be a sign of insulation damage or inefficiencies. Check your insulation for any signs of damage or wear and tear.

Common Questions About Insulation Water Damage Restoration

Q: What causes insulation water damage?

A: Insulation water damage can be caused by various factors, including roof leaks, plumbing issues, and high humidity levels.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and potential health risks.

Q: What are the health risks associated with insulation water damage?

A: Insulation water damage can lead to mold growth, which can cause respiratory issues and other health problems. It’s crucial to have a professional inspect your insulation to ensure it’s safe and healthy to live in.

Q: How long does insulation water damage restoration take?

A: The duration of insulation water damage restoration dep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work diligently to complete the job as quickly as possible, but it’s essential to focus on quality over speed.

Q: Do I need to replace all of my insulation?

A: Not necessarily. In some cases, it may be possible to repair or replace only the damaged insulation. Our team will assess the situation and provide a customized solution to meet your needs and budget.
